Mesothelioma Life Expectancy

The news that you have mesothelioma may be a life-changing event. Patients are often told they have only a few months to live after diagnosis.

Mesothelioma is a cancer that develops in the lung's lining (pleura) and, less frequently, in the the abdominal cavity (peritoneum). Exposure to asbestos is the main risk factor for this cancer.

Age

Mesothelioma affects the linings of organs such as the stomach and lungs. It usually develops 30-50 years after exposure to asbestos. Mesothelioma symptoms are often similar to other diseases and conditions that make it difficult to determine. Mesothelioma sufferers can live longer when they are diagnosed early and treated for the type of mesothelioma they suffer from.

Mesothelioma prognosis can also be affected by the stage mesothelioma a patient is in. Doctors describe stages of mesothelioma based on how far the cancer has spread. For instance, those who have stage 1 mesothelioma can have a better prognosis than those who have mesothelioma at later stages due to it being simpler to treat cancer that hasn't yet been able to spread.

The type of mesothelioma may affect the prognosis of a patient since the cancers are classified according to their cell types. There are two main types of mesothelioma cell types: epithelioid and sarcomatoid. Sometimes, tumors contain both cells (biphasic mesothelioma). Epithelioid Mesothelioma, which is the most common type of mesothelioma, is more responsive to treatments than sarcomatoid.

Gender

While men comprise the majority of patients diagnosed with mesothelioma, women are diagnosed with these life-altering diseases in equal numbers. Mesothelioma is typically viewed as a male-only disease because of its association with blue-collar jobs and exposure to worksite. asbestos lawyer was extensively used in construction for much of the 20th century, and a lot of male workers had daily exposure to the material.

The main cause of mesothelioma is occupational asbestos legal (they said) exposure. However, mesothelioma can result through exposure to asbestos at home or from other sources such as the environment. Studies have found that men and women are equally impacted by asbestos even after exposure has been diminished or eliminated from workplace.

Mesothelioma sufferers have a less extensive experience of exposure to workplaces. Many of them were affected by their husbands' or other family members' exposure to occupational hazards. Certain people were exposed to asbestos through environmental exposure like contaminated homes or schools.

A recent study of gender differences in patients diagnosed with mesothelioma showed a variety of significant dynamic. The study, conducted by Mesothelioma UK in collaboration with 12 King's Bench Walk, HASAG and Irwin Mitchell, focused on mesothelioma patient experiences throughout the various stages of diagnosis. The study found that gender plays a significant role in how patients approach their treatment and legal options.

For example females are more emotionally involved in the decision-making process for their legal strategy. As a result, they tend to be more aware of the effects on their loved ones, and prioritize decisions that are most in line with their familial responsibility. Men, however are more focused on their medical and financial futures and choose more aggressive treatment and clinical trials. This is especially true for patients with pleural msothelioma. It is important to remember that a mesothelioma diagnosis can be stressful for both men and women. Even if the symptoms are not yet evident the diagnosis can impact the quality of life of a patient. It is important to understand that each patient has their own needs, regardless of gender.

Treatment

Asbestos fibers are small and can easily enter the lungs when inhaled. These fibers can cause mesothelioma when they irritate organ linings. It takes between 10 and 50 years for symptoms to be evident, and they could be mistaken for more common diseases like pneumonia or the flu.

Mesothelioma symptoms include abdominal pain, chest discomfort, and breathing difficulties. A mesothelioma diagnosis requires a medical exam as well as an extensive health history in order to determine the source of these symptoms. Doctors will examine the patient's overall health as well as their smoking habits and overall fitness level. They will also inquire whether the patient has been exposed to asbestos.

A patient's physician may recommend imaging scans and blood tests to confirm a mesothelioma diagnosis. These tests can help doctors determine if the mesothelioma has spread to the lungs or abdomen, and what type of cells it is. Patients with mesothelioma generally have epithelioid or sarcomatoid tumor cells. The epithelioid cells are the most prevalent and more sensitive to treatment. The sarcomatoid cells are more susceptible to grow and have a less favorable prognosis.

Treatments for mesothelioma could include chemo, surgery, and radiation. These procedures can boost the life expectancy of patients suffering from mesothelioma. Doctors can create individualized treatment plans for each patient, taking into account factors such as the type of cancer and stage.

The patient's age and overall health can affect the survival rate of mesothelioma. Smoking can make pleural cancer more likely and decrease survival rates. In addition, patients who are older have a harder time fighting off the disease and are less likely to respond to treatment options such as immunotherapy. Positive attitudes and seeking support from family members can increase the chances of survival for patients.
